Material Costs - The cost of slate roofing materials typically ranges from $10 to $20 per square foot, with premium options reaching higher prices. For a standard 1,500-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from $15,000 to $30,000. These costs depend on the quality and thickness of the slate chosen.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for slate roof construction usually fall between $30 and $50 per hour, totaling approximately $5,000 to $15,000 for an average-sized roof. The complexity of the installation and roof pitch can influence overall labor charges. Local pros may provide estimates based on specific project details.
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more intricate slate roof projects tend to increase overall costs, with larger roofs potentially exceeding $50,000. Factors such as roof shape, number of chimneys, and custom features can add to the expense. Contractors will typically assess these elements during estimates.
Additional Expenses - Costs for roof removal, disposal, and necessary repairs can add several thousand dollars to the total project. For example, tear-off and disposal might range from $1,000 to $3,000 depending on the existing roof condition. Local service providers can provide detailed cost breakdowns for these services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of slate roof construction?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ural beauty,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for historic and high-end properties in Evans City, PA and surrounding areas.
How long does a slate roof typically last? When properly installed and maintained, slate roofs can last 75 years or more, often outlasting other roofing materials.
What factors influence the cost of slate roof construction? The cost can vary depending on the size of the roof, the type of slate used, and the complexity of the installation, with local pros providing detailed estimates.
Are there different styles of slate roofing available? Yes, slate roofs come in various styles and colors, allowing for customization to match architectural preferences and aesthetic goals.
What maintenance is required for a slate roof? Regular inspections and prompt repairs of any damaged slates help preserve the roof’s integrity and appearance over time.
